Summary: The Quiron-Valencia Sample includes resting state datasets collected from a community sample in Valencia, Spain. The first release includes data for 45 participants. Each participant has an anatomical as well as a resting state fMRI scan. Participants were instructed to keep their eyes open during the resting state scan, no visual stimulus was presented.
